Great news, Mike. My dad had a mitral valve replacement with a mechanical valve. The valve was still working 25 years later when he passed at 95 years old. What I learned over the years watching him, is to not skip scheduled blood tests, don't make any drastic changes to your diet, because it affects blood thickness, (watch those green leafy vegs, which thicken the blood) and develop a good working relationship with your cardiologist. My dad's dr. became like a family member to us. I'm still in touch with him -- 5 years after my dad's passing.
